Common Standing Desk Buying Mistakes
Many buyers make errors that can lead to discomfort, wasted money, or an unsuitable workspace. Being aware of these pitfalls can save you time and resources.
1. Ignoring Ergonomic Features
Choosing a desk without adjustable height, or without enough range, can cause strain. Look for desks with smooth, easy-to-use height adjustments and features like keyboard trays and monitor stands.
2. Overlooking Desk Stability
A wobbly desk can be dangerous and uncomfortable. Test the desk for stability and ensure it can support your equipment without shaking or wobbling.
3. Not Considering Space and Size
Choosing a desk that is too small or too large for your workspace can hinder productivity. Measure your space carefully and select a desk that fits comfortably without cluttering your area.
4. Ignoring Material Quality
Low-quality materials may look attractive but can wear out quickly. Invest in sturdy, durable materials like solid wood or high-quality metal to ensure longevity.
5. Forgetting About Cable Management
Good cable management is essential for safety and aesthetics. Look for desks with built-in cable trays or plan how you’ll organize cords to avoid clutter.
Tips for a Successful Purchase
To avoid mistakes, do thorough research. Read reviews, compare features, and consider your specific needs. Visiting stores to test desks in person can also be helpful.
Assess Your Needs
- Determine the ideal height range for your sitting and standing positions.
- Identify the amount of workspace you need for your tasks.
- Consider additional features like storage or integrated power outlets.
Set a Budget
Standing desks come in a wide price range. Establish a budget that balances quality and affordability to get the best value.
